ADPR 542 - Strategic Comm Management
Overview of leadership and management of goal-driven strategic communication in multiple contexts (e.g., for-profit, non-profit, agency). Examines theories and case studies to explore topics such as research and evaluation, issues management, message and channel strategies, project management, budgeting, and communication with multiple stakeholders. Emphasizes professional ethics and standards. Registration Restriction(s): Minimum student level – graduate.
3.000 Credit hours
3.000 Lecture hours
